A STUDY OF FEASIBILITY OF UTILIZING IONIZING RADIATION TO INCREASE THE STORAGE LIFE OF POTATOES. Progress Report No. 8 (for) January 1, 1958-February 28, 1958

Potatoes harvested in the faII of 1956 and irradiated at levels from 0.0 to 15.0 kilo-reps were stored at 41 deg F. Nonirradiated check tubers of all varieties sprouted and underwent some shriveling. Irradiated tubers of the varieties Sebago, Red Pontiac, and Katahdin, with no sprouts, also shriveled to various degrees, whereas identically treated Russet Burbanks are still quite turgid. Loss of moistre from the potatoes stored at 41 deg F was determined by periodic weighings. Data on the accumulative percentages of weight lost 380 days after the potatoes were first weighed into the experiment are tabulated. Results from limited cooking tests are included. (C.H.)
